Output 9065824998283ccc2f79be58e5a829a2a1d19e84a46db6c97bf04cf6466ef952:1

value
171453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 912938db98a46cb5b669a5736573c02ddc0dae8d OP_EQUAL
address
3EvZHXAh1U11dVek26EmChbzAhfgeVE4wq
transaction
9065824998283ccc2f79be58e5a829a2a1d19e84a46db6c97bf04cf6466ef952
spent
true